# Simulate some data for this example:
population <- simulatePopulations(createSimulationSettings(nSites = 1))[[1]]
# Fit a Cox regression at each data site, and approximate likelihood function:
cyclopsData <- Cyclops::createCyclopsData(Surv(time, y) ~ x + strata(stratumId),
data = population,
modelType = "cox"
)
cyclopsFit <- Cyclops::fitCyclopsModel(cyclopsData)
likelihoodProfile <- approximateLikelihood(cyclopsFit, parameter = "x", approximation = "grid")
# Run MCMC
mcmcTraces <- approximateSimplePosterior(
likelihoodProfile = likelihoodProfile,
priorMean = 0, priorSd = 100
)
# Report posterior expectation
mean(mcmcTraces$theta)
# (Estimates in this example will vary due to the random simulation)
